Thomas Michael Lawless, 50, of Rumson, passed away March 5. He was born in Brooklyn, New York and moved to New Jersey during high school.
Thomas graduated from Montclair State with a bachelor’s degree in accounting. He enjoyed his time he spent in the TKE Fraternity where he made lifelong friends. Thomas worked 28 years in public accounting and was a partner at PriceWaterhouseCoopers.
Thomas was a member of the Navesink Country Club where he was an avid golfer. Most of all, Thomas found joy spending time with his family creating memories in his home which he loved and was so proud of.
He is predeceased by his mother Ruth (Olsen) Lawless.
Surviving is his wife Dena Ann Lawless; his sons Tyler and Ryan Lawless; his brothers Kevin Wingler and his wife Barbara; William Lawless and his wife Andrea; and Sherrie Wingler and her husband Wes. Also surviving are many nieces, nephews and friends.
Visitation was held March 8 at the John E. Day Funeral Home, Red Bank. A Mass of Christian Burial was held March 9 at Holy Cross Roman Catholic Church, Rumson. Interment followed at Mt. Olivet Cemetery in Middletown. Immediately following the burial, the celebration of Thomas’s life continued at Navesink Country Club, Middletown.
